Gamalama is a near-conical active stratovolcano that comprises the entire Ternate island in Indonesia. The island lies off the western shore of Halmahera island in the north of the Maluku Islands. For centuries, Ternate was a center of Portuguese and Dutch forts for spice trade, which have accounted for thorough reports of Gamalama's volcanic activities.
== Geology == Mount Gamalama is one of the most active volcanoes in Indonesia. Between 1550 and 2015, 77 different eruptions have been documented. The 2015 eruption gave very short precursor signs (less than 24 hours). Eruptions range from basaltic effusive lava flows to more violent andesitic eruptions that are characterized with large and dangerous pyroclastic flows.
